Most Affordable Electric Sedans
If you're looking for an affordable electric vehicle that isn't an SUV, this list is for you. Car and Driver's rankings are arrived at from the results of our extensive instrumented testing of several hundred vehicles each year and from our expert editors' subjective impressions gained in real-world driving. We've ranked the least expensive electric sedans, coupes, and hatchbacks based on their respective manufacturer's suggested retail price (MSRP), and gave each car a rating based on roughly 200 data points encompassing acceleration, handling, comfort, cargo space, fuel efficiency, value, and how enjoyable they are to drive. All of these electric models have a base price of under $75,000.
